Mold in Staten Island homes, crawl spaces, and basements

Staten Island's single-family homes, townhouses, and condos give mold room to hide in crawl spaces, basements, and attics, the damp, low-airflow places moisture collects. Leaks, humidity, and poor ventilation start it, and the East Shore's storm and Sandy-era flooding left plenty of homes with moisture in the structure. Because the homes are larger, mold can spread across more square footage before anyone notices. We find the source, remove the mold under containment, and correct what feeds it.

Do you handle crawl-space mold?

Yes. Crawl spaces trap moisture and grow mold out of sight. We inspect, remove it under containment, and address the humidity that feeds it.

We had storm flooding, is there mold now?

Often, yes, mold can start within a day or two of water sitting. We check for hidden moisture and remove any mold at the source.
